Understanding the concept of DeFi

Decentralized Finance, or DeFi, is a revolutionary concept that is transforming the traditional financial system. DeFi aims to provide an open and permissionless financial ecosystem that is accessible to everyone, regardless of their location or background. By leveraging blockchain technology, DeFi eliminates the need for intermediaries such as banks or financial institutions, allowing users to directly interact with each other in a trustless manner.

One of the key principles of DeFi is the concept of decentralization, which means that no single entity has control over the entire system. Instead, decisions are made collectively by the community through decentralized governance mechanisms. This not only increases transparency and reduces the risk of manipulation but also ensures that the system is more resilient to external attacks or failures.

Another important aspect of DeFi is the use of smart contracts, which are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. Smart contracts automate the process of financial transactions, eliminating the need for intermediaries and reducing the associated costs. This not only makes transactions faster and more efficient but also minimizes the risk of human error.

Furthermore, DeFi platforms offer a wide range of financial services, including lending, borrowing, trading, and asset management. Users can access these services directly from their digital wallets, without the need for a traditional bank account or financial institution. This not only provides greater financial inclusion but also gives users more control over their assets and financial decisions.

Overall, DeFi has the potential to democratize finance globally by providing a more inclusive, transparent, and efficient financial system. As the DeFi ecosystem continues to grow and evolve, it is important for users to understand the principles and mechanisms behind DeFi in order to fully leverage its benefits and participate in the future of finance.

Challenges and opportunities in the DeFi space

One of the key challenges in the DeFi space is the lack of regulation, which can lead to potential risks for investors. Without proper oversight, there is a higher chance of scams and fraudulent activities taking place. It is essential for the industry to work towards establishing regulatory frameworks to protect users and promote trust in decentralized finance.

On the other hand, the DeFi space also presents numerous opportunities for individuals globally. By eliminating the need for intermediaries, DeFi allows for greater financial inclusion and access to services that were previously unavailable to many. This can empower individuals in developing countries to participate in the global economy and take control of their financial future.

Furthermore, the decentralized nature of DeFi opens up opportunities for innovation and collaboration. Developers from around the world can contribute to the growth of the ecosystem, creating new and exciting products that can benefit users across borders. This collaborative environment fosters creativity and pushes the boundaries of what is possible in the world of finance.
